Kawasaki Z900 suspension setup and specs

Kawasaki Z900, 2017 to 2019: adjustable front preload and rebound, rear preload and rebound, 795 mm (31.3 in) seat height, 120 mm of front suspension travel.

Model years covered: 2017, 2018, 2019 — these share the same suspension hardware. Figures as published by Kawasaki.
